Output 7358c8f81f3c73fcb483bfe2aea73a00724a7a704241b95cba8cf8521911b94a:71

value
353767880
script pubkey
OP_0 OP_PUSHBYTES_20 05de6f45a130a97872e878a6ba64500f101379a9
address
ltc1qqh0x73dpxz5hsuhg0znt5ezspugpx7df23z0kx
transaction
7358c8f81f3c73fcb483bfe2aea73a00724a7a704241b95cba8cf8521911b94a
spent
true